What's worse, Little John's crews are clueless when it comes to pruning trees. Everyone know you don't cut branches halfway along their length, as shown in the second photo below. It's ugly and it damages the tree.
You're supposed to prune the branch back just short of the collar where it extends off from the previous branch. This looks much more attractive and gives the tree a chance to heal over the cut.
